Byline: Megan Hinds
Mar. 13--TWIN FALLS -- As Magic Valley's economy grows, area banking institutions are expanding right along with it.
A number of banks with a presence in Magic Valley plan to expand this year by adding new branches as well as employees, making it "a good time to be a banker in Magic Valley." Those are the words of Magic Valley Bank Regional President Phil Bratton, whose bank in 2004 became a division of Sandpoint-based Panhandle State Bank.
